How they compare
Maldives currently reports 39.1% against 38.0% in North Macedonia, a difference of 1.1%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 35 shared years of data; in 1991 it was North Macedonia ahead.
Maldives ranks 144th and North Macedonia ranks 146th of 186 countries.
Maldives has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Maldives | North Macedonia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 27.5% | 27.2% | 0.3% | Maldives |
| 2000s | 33.8% | 27.2% | 6.6% | Maldives |
| 2010s | 35.7% | 31.1% | 4.6% | Maldives |
| 2020s | 37.9% | 36.7% | 1.2% | Maldives |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
